From da5aabca172c11b9d398dc47664786a1f84913bd Mon Sep 17 00:00:00 2001 From: Gabriel Bourgault Date: Mon, 30 Jul 2018 22:28:50 -0700 Subject: [PATCH] feat(icons): Update font awesome to 5.2.0 --- angular.json | 2 +- package-lock.json | 11 ++++++----- package.json | 2 +- src/app/pages/ui-features/icons/icons.component.html | 2 +- src/app/pages/ui-features/icons/icons.component.ts | 12 ++++++------ 5 files changed, 15 insertions(+), 14 deletions(-) diff --git a/angular.json b/angular.json index c7c0132ef4..3a329f8191 100644 --- a/angular.json +++ b/angular.json @@ -32,7 +32,7 @@ "node_modules/typeface-exo/index.css", "node_modules/roboto-fontface/css/roboto/roboto-fontface.css", "node_modules/ionicons/scss/ionicons.scss", - "node_modules/font-awesome/scss/font-awesome.scss", + "node_modules/@fortawesome/fontawesome-free/css/all.css", "node_modules/socicon/css/socicon.css", "node_modules/nebular-icons/scss/nebular-icons.scss", "node_modules/angular-tree-component/dist/angular-tree-component.css", diff --git a/package-lock.json b/package-lock.json index feba51a721..4c600d9a3d 100644 --- a/package-lock.json +++ b/package-lock.json @@ -689,6 +689,12 @@ "viz.js": "1.8.0" } }, + "@fortawesome/fontawesome-free": { + "version": "5.2.0", + "resolved": "https://registry.npmjs.org/@fortawesome/fontawesome-free/-/fontawesome-free-5.2.0.tgz", + "integrity": "sha512-4pgStJx9UmydKc7wwF6Xjw4dFqzUnQejeuP2aUNHWazayWbmMbrx5rieN9+oob4bUwkf1thS3am0Ko+uhFHpNA==", + "dev": true + }, "@nebular/auth": { "version": "2.0.0-rc.9", "resolved": "https://registry.npmjs.org/@nebular/auth/-/auth-2.0.0-rc.9.tgz", @@ -5048,11 +5054,6 @@ "readable-stream": "2.3.4" } }, - "font-awesome": { - "version": "4.7.0", - "resolved": "https://registry.npmjs.org/font-awesome/-/font-awesome-4.7.0.tgz", - "integrity": "sha1-j6jPBBGhoxr9B7BtKQK7n8gVoTM=" - }, "for-in": { "version": "1.0.2", "resolved": "https://registry.npmjs.org/for-in/-/for-in-1.0.2.tgz", diff --git a/package.json b/package.json index 71c8edbaab..0797fc71a0 100644 --- a/package.json +++ b/package.json @@ -59,7 +59,6 @@ "classlist.js": "1.1.20150312", "core-js": "2.5.1", "echarts": "^4.0.2", - "font-awesome": "4.7.0", "intl": "1.2.5", "ionicons": "2.0.1", "leaflet": "1.2.0", @@ -83,6 +82,7 @@ "@angular/compiler-cli": "6.0.0", "@angular/language-service": "6.0.0", "@compodoc/compodoc": "1.0.1", + "@fortawesome/fontawesome-free": "^5.2.0", "@types/d3-color": "1.0.5", "@types/googlemaps": "3.30.4", "@types/jasmine": "2.5.54", diff --git a/src/app/pages/ui-features/icons/icons.component.html b/src/app/pages/ui-features/icons/icons.component.html index c40b3225db..0aedaf9d60 100644 --- a/src/app/pages/ui-features/icons/icons.component.html +++ b/src/app/pages/ui-features/icons/icons.component.html @@ -19,7 +19,7 @@
- +
diff --git a/src/app/pages/ui-features/icons/icons.component.ts b/src/app/pages/ui-features/icons/icons.component.ts index 4af2704b58..07e9bf9ef9 100644 --- a/src/app/pages/ui-features/icons/icons.component.ts +++ b/src/app/pages/ui-features/icons/icons.component.ts @@ -44,12 +44,12 @@ export class IconsComponent { ], fontAwesome: [ - 'fa fa-adjust', 'fa fa-anchor', 'fa fa-archive', 'fa fa-area-chart', 'fa fa-arrows', 'fa fa-arrows-h', - 'fa fa-arrows-v', 'fa fa-asterisk', 'fa fa-at', 'fa fa-automobile', 'fa fa-ban', 'fa fa-bank', - 'fa fa-bar-chart', 'fa fa-bar-chart-o', 'fa fa-barcode', 'fa fa-bars', 'fa fa-bed', 'fa fa-beer', - 'fa fa-bell', 'fa fa-bell-o', 'fa fa-bell-slash', 'fa fa-bell-slash-o', 'fa fa-bicycle', 'fa fa-binoculars', - 'fa fa-birthday-cake', 'fa fa-bolt', 'fa fa-bomb', 'fa fa-book', 'fa fa-bookmark', 'fa fa-bookmark-o', - 'fa fa-briefcase', 'fa fa-bug', 'fa fa-building', 'fa fa-building-o', 'fa fa-bullhorn', + 'fa fa-adjust', 'fa fa-anchor', 'fa fa-archive', 'fa fa-chart-area', 'fa fa-arrows-alt', 'fa fa-arrows-alt-h', + 'fa fa-arrows-alt-v', 'fa fa-asterisk', 'fa fa-at', 'fa fa-car', 'fa fa-ban', 'fa fa-university', + 'fa fa-chart-bar', 'far fa-chart-bar', 'fa fa-barcode', 'fa fa-bars', 'fa fa-bed', 'fa fa-beer', + 'fa fa-bell', 'far fa-bell', 'fa fa-bell-slash', 'far fa-bell-slash', 'fa fa-bicycle', 'fa fa-binoculars', + 'fa fa-birthday-cake', 'fa fa-bolt', 'fa fa-bomb', 'fa fa-book', 'fa fa-bookmark', 'far fa-bookmark', + 'fa fa-briefcase', 'fa fa-bug', 'fa fa-building', 'far fa-building', 'fa fa-bullhorn', ], };